CTM Faxing Service

Faxing is available on Marketing Pro, Sales Engage, Enterprise, Performance, Growth, and Connect plans.

Note: Tracking numbers can be used for fax or voice, but not both simultaneously.

 

Enabling a Fax Number

To send or receive a fax, you will need to enable a Fax number.

  • To use faxing, you will need a fax-enabled phone number. To buy a fax-enabled number, go to the Buy Numbers page and click the Request a Number button at the top right corner of the page. Fill out the request based on your needs. 
  • Once acquired, go to Numbers → Fax Numbers, select → Set up as Fax number

Note:

  • Tracking numbers can be used for fax or voice, but not both simultaneously. 
  • Once you set up a fax number, it can no longer receive voice calls (until you switch it back by going to the fax numbers page and reactivating it as a voice number). 
  • Once you switch the number to a voice number, a prompt will appear telling you that you can no longer receive faxes. 
  • The file size limit for faxes is 50MB or 350 pages. 

Send a Fax

  1. To send a new fax, select → New Fax 
  2. Add a “To” Number 
  3. Select a “From” number for the recipient (If multiple fax numbers are enabled, you’ll be able to select multiple fax numbers that show up in the drop-down)
  4. Select a PDF document you would like to send. Note: Only PDF documents are supported at this time
  5. Select → Choose File (choose file) 
  6. Click Send Fax

Troubleshooting 

If a fax is stuck in the uploading status, it usually means it's having trouble sending. This can be caused by a slow connection, a large file, or a problem with the receiving fax machine. To troubleshoot this, try the following:

  • Check the internet or phone connection
  • Try sending again 
  • Reduce the file size or number of pages
  • Use a short, simple file name
  • Ask the recipient to check their fax machine to ensure there are no issues

Activity Fax Log

The fax log can be found in Activity → Faxes.  This log will show all inbound and outbound that are in progress or have been received.

Other Notes:

  • Charges apply for both inbound and outbound faxes per page
  • If redaction is turned on, it will delete fax content as part of the scheduled redactions period
  • The fax documents will be available to view for the life of the account unless redaction has been implemented
